Requirement
AI-related jobs in Germany require a solid understanding of programming languages such as Python and R, as well as expertise in machine learning and data analysis. Familiarity with frameworks like TensorFlow and PyTorch is often necessary to develop AI models effectively. Employers also value skills in data visualization and statistical analysis, which help in interpreting complex datasets. Strong problem-solving abilities and a solid educational background in computer science or mathematics can significantly enhance your candidacy in this competitive job market.
Salary and Perks Expected
AI-related jobs in Germany offer competitive salaries, typically ranging from EUR50,000 to over EUR100,000 annually, depending on experience and specialization. Perks often include flexible working hours, remote work options, and professional development opportunities, making these positions attractive to aspiring professionals. Major cities like Berlin, Munich, and Frankfurt are hubs for AI innovation, hosting numerous tech companies and startups that are continually on the lookout for talent. Understanding the local job market and networking within industry circles can significantly enhance your chances of securing a fulfilling role in this rapidly growing field.

List of Ideal City
Germany offers several cities that are particularly favorable for AI-related jobs, driven by a robust tech ecosystem and research institutions. Berlin stands out with its vibrant startup scene and numerous tech companies, attracting talent from around the world. Munich is also a hub for AI, hosting major corporations and research facilities, along with a growing number of AI startups. Stuttgart, known for its engineering excellence, provides opportunities in automotive AI applications, making it an attractive option for professionals in the field.
